No, there is no minimum guaranteed settlement amount. The facts of every case are different. Some personal injury cases do not offer any settlements but others may over multi million dollar verdicts or settlements.

In some states, drivers are required to carry Personal Injury Protection (PIP) coverage, which provides them with compensation for injury-related damages through their own policies. Vermont is not one of those states.

Vermont negligence laws follow the doctrine of modified comparative negligence.

The State liability limits for Vermont are $25,000 per person, $50,000 per accident and $10,000 property damage.

Auto insurance requirements in Vermont Vermont requires all motorists in the state to carry car insurance to be considered a legal driver. Proof of insurance must also be carried when you are behind the wheel and must be shown at the request of law enforcement officials.

Vermont is an ?at-fault? state (also called a tort state). The person who is responsible for causing a car accident must pay the costs for other involved people's injuries and property damage.

In most cases, Vermont has a three-year statute of limitations for personal injury claims. To be clear, this means that the victim's case must be initiated within three years, not that it has to be completely resolved within that time frame.
